Exploring Diverse Rides and Commute Options
Modern urban centers offer a wide array of options for rides and commuting. Traditional taxi services provide door-to-door transport, often available through street hailing, phone calls, or dedicated apps. The rise of on-demand ride-sharing platforms has further diversified these choices, allowing passengers to request vehicles instantly via smartphones. These services offer a flexible alternative to owning a private car, providing convenience for short trips or longer journeys. Additionally, many cities are investing in shared mobility solutions, such as bike-sharing and scooter-sharing programs, which offer quick and eco-friendly options for navigating shorter distances within the city.

Logistics, Routes, Efficiency, and Fleets
Behind every successful urban transportation system lies complex logistics, careful route planning, and a focus on operational efficiency. Service providers manage fleets of vehicles, ensuring they are strategically positioned to meet demand. Advanced algorithms are often employed to optimize routes, minimize empty travel, and reduce fuel consumption. This systematic approach enhances the overall efficiency of the service, benefiting both the provider and the passenger through quicker response times and potentially lower fares. The management of these fleets, from maintenance to driver scheduling, is critical for maintaining a high standard of service and reliability in a bustling city environment.
Urban transportation services, particularly taxi and ride-sharing options, involve varying cost structures. These can include per-mile rates, per-minute charges, base fares, and sometimes surge pricing during peak demand. The overall cost of a journey is influenced by distance, time of day, traffic conditions, and the specific service chosen. It is common for apps to provide an estimated fare before confirming a ride, allowing passengers to compare options. Different providers may also have different pricing models for similar services.
| Product/Service | Provider | Cost Estimation |
|---|---|---|
| Standard Ride | UberX | $1.00 - $2.50 per mile (plus base fare/time) |
| Standard Ride | Lyft Standard | $1.00 - $2.50 per mile (plus base fare/time) |
| Taxi Service | Local Taxi Companies (e.g., Yellow Cab) | Metered rates, typically $2.50 - $4.00 initial fare + $2.00 - $3.50 per mile |
| Premium Ride | Uber Black | $3.00 - $6.00 per mile (plus base fare/time) |
| Shared Ride | Uber Pool / Lyft Shared | 20% - 40% less than standard ride |
